2009 | ||
---|---|---|
89 | EE | Kostas Kontogiannis, Christos Tjortjis, Andreas Winter: Special issue on the 12th conference on software maintenance and reengineering (CSMR 2008). Journal of Software Maintenance 21(2): 79-80 (2009) |
2008 | ||
88 | EE | Ali Razavi, Kostas Kontogiannis: Pattern and Policy Driven Log Analysis for Software Monitoring. COMPSAC 2008: 108-111 |
87 | EE | Grace A. Lewis, Dennis B. Smith, Kostas Kontogiannis: SOAM 2008: 2nd Workshop on SOA-Based Systems Maintenance and Evolution. CSMR 2008: 336-337 |
86 | EE | Kostas Kontogiannis, Grace A. Lewis, Dennis B. Smith, Marin Litoiu: SDSOA 2008: second international workshop on systems development in SOA environments. ICSE Companion 2008: 1047-1048 |
85 | EE | Grace A. Lewis, Dennis B. Smith, Kostas Kontogiannis: MESOA 2008: 2nd international workshop on a research agenda for maintenance and evolution of service-oriented systems. ICSM 2008: 406-407 |
2007 | ||
84 | EE | Kostas Kontogiannis, Grace A. Lewis, Dennis B. Smith, Marin Litoiu, Stefan Schuster: SDSOA 2007: International Workshop on Systems Development in SOA Environments. ICSE Companion 2007: 133-134 |
83 | EE | Grace A. Lewis, Dennis B. Smith, Kostas Kontogiannis, Scott R. Tilley, Mira Kajko-Mattsson, Ned Chapin: A Research Agenda for Maintenance & Evolution of SOA-Based Systems. ICSM 2007: 481-484 |
2006 | ||
82 | Kostas Kontogiannis, Ying Zou, Massimiliano Di Penta: 13th International Workshop on Software Technology and Engineering Practice (STEP 2005), 24-25 September 2005, Budapest, Hungary IEEE Computer Society 2006 | |
81 | EE | Igor Ivkovic, Kostas Kontogiannis: A Framework for Software Architecture Refactoring using Model Transformations and Semantic Annotations. CSMR 2006: 135-144 |
80 | EE | Thomas R. Dean, Massimiliano Di Penta, Kostas Kontogiannis, Andrew Walenstein: Clone Detector Use Questions: A List of Desirable Empirical Studies. Duplication, Redundancy, and Similarity in Software 2006 |
79 | EE | Kostas Kontogiannis: Managing Known Clones: Issues and Open Questions. Duplication, Redundancy, and Similarity in Software 2006 |
78 | EE | Dennis B. Smith, Liam O'Brien, Kostas Kontogiannis: Working Session: Program Comprehension and Migration Strategies for Web Service and Service-Oriented Architectures. ICPC 2006: 235-240 |
77 | EE | Kostas Kontogiannis, Panagiotis K. Linos, Kenny Wong: Comprehension and Maintenance of Large-Scale Multi-Language Software Applications. ICSM 2006: 497-500 |
76 | EE | Kostas Kontogiannis: Model Driven Evolution of Network-Centric Applications: Perspectives, Challenges, and Issues. WSE 2006: 3 |
75 | EE | Igor Ivkovic, Kostas Kontogiannis: Towards Automatic Establishment of Model Dependencies Using Formal Concept Analysis. International Journal of Software Engineering and Knowledge Engineering 16(4): 499-522 (2006) |
74 | EE | Francoise Balmas, Kostas Kontogiannis: Introduction to the special issue on software analysis, evolution and reengineering. Sci. Comput. Program. 60(2): 117-120 (2006) |
2005 | ||
73 | EE | Raihan Al-Ekram, Kostas Kontogiannis: An XML-Based Framework for Language Neutral Program Representation and Generic Analysis. CSMR 2005: 42-51 |
72 | EE | Igor Ivkovic, Kostas Kontogiannis: Using Formal Concept Analysis to Establish Model Dependencies. ITCC (2) 2005: 365-372 |
71 | EE | Scott R. Tilley, Kostas Kontogiannis: Report from the 4th International Workshop on Net-Centric Computing (NCC 2005). STEP 2005: 159-162 |
2004 | ||
70 | EE | Alvin Chin, Kostas Kontogiannis: m-Roam: A Service Invocation and Roaming Framework for Pervasive Computing. AINA (1) 2004: 385-392 |
69 | EE | Raihan Al-Ekram, Kostas Kontogiannis: An XML-Based Framework for Language Neutral Program Representation and Generic Analysis. COMPSAC Workshops 2004: 10-11 |
68 | EE | Raihan Al-Ekram, Kostas Kontogiannis: Source Code Modularization Using Lattice of Concept Slices. CSMR 2004: 195-203 |
67 | EE | Yu Ping, Kostas Kontogiannis: Refactoring Web sites to the Controller-Centric Architecture. CSMR 2004: 204-213 |
66 | EE | Igor Ivkovic, Kostas Kontogiannis: Tracing Evolution Changes of Software Artifacts through Model Synchronization. ICSM 2004: 252-261 |
65 | EE | Ladan Tahvildari, Kostas Kontogiannis: Developing a Multi-Objective Decision Approach to Select Source-Code Improving Transformations. ICSM 2004: 427-431 |
64 | EE | Terence C. Lau, Tack Tong, Ross McKegney, Kostas Kontogiannis, Igor Ivkovic, Philip Liew, Ying Zou, Qi Zhang, Maokeng Hung: Model Synchronization for Efficient Software Application Maintenance. ICSM 2004: 499 |
63 | EE | Ladan Tahvildari, Kostas Kontogiannis: Requirements Driven Software Evolution. IWPC 2004: 258-259 |
62 | EE | Igor Ivkovic, Kostas Kontogiannis: Model synchronization as a problem of maximizing model dependencies. OOPSLA Companion 2004: 222-223 |
61 | EE | Philip Liew, Kostas Kontogiannis, Tack Tong: A Framework for Business Model Driven Development. STEP 2004: 47-56 |
60 | EE | Faryaaz Kassam, Kostas Kontogiannis: Quality and Constraint Driven Workflow Composition. STEP 2004: 76-88 |
59 | EE | Ying Zou, Terence C. Lau, Kostas Kontogiannis, Tack Tong, Ross McKegney: Model-Driven Business Process Recovery. WCRE 2004: 224-233 |
58 | EE | Ladan Tahvildari, Kostas Kontogiannis: Improving design quality using meta-pattern transformations: a metric-based approach. Journal of Software Maintenance 16(4-5): 331-361 (2004) |
2003 | ||
57 | EE | Yu Ping, Jianguo Lu, Terence C. Lau, Kostas Kontogiannis, Tack Tong, Bo Yi: Migration of legacy web applications to enterprise JavaTM environments net.data® to JSPTM transformation. CASCON 2003: 223-237 |
56 | EE | Ying Zou, Kostas Kontogiannis: Incremental Transformation of Procedural Systems to Object Oriented Platforms. COMPSAC 2003: 290-295 |
55 | EE | Ladan Tahvildari, Kostas Kontogiannis: A Metric-Based Approach to Enhance Design Quality through Meta-pattern Transformation. CSMR 2003: 183-192 |
54 | EE | Kamran Sartipi, Kostas Kontogiannis: On Modeling Software Architecture Recovery as Graph Matching. ICSM 2003: 224-234 |
53 | EE | Yu Ping, Kostas Kontogiannis, Terence C. Lau: Transforming Legacy Web Applications to the MVC Architecture. STEP 2003: 133-142 |
52 | EE | Michael Ryan Bannon, Kostas Kontogiannis: Semantic Web Data Description and Discovery. STEP 2003: 143-152 |
51 | EE | Ladan Tahvildari, Kostas Kontogiannis: First International Workshop on Refactoring : Achievements, Challenges, and Effects (REFACE?03). WCRE 2003: 369-370 |
50 | EE | Terence C. Lau, Jianguo Lu, John Mylopoulos, Kostas Kontogiannis: The Migration of Multi-tier E-commerce Applications to an Enterprise Java Environment. Information Systems Frontiers 5(2): 149-160 (2003) |
49 | EE | Kamran Sartipi, Kostas Kontogiannis: A user-assisted approach to component clustering. Journal of Software Maintenance 15(4): 265-295 (2003) |
48 | EE | Ladan Tahvildari, Kostas Kontogiannis, John Mylopoulos: Quality-driven software re-engineering. Journal of Systems and Software 66(3): 225-239 (2003) |
2002 | ||
47 | EE | Ying Zou, Kostas Kontogiannis: Quality Driven Transformation Compositions for Object Oriented Migration. APSEC 2002: 346- |
46 | EE | Ladan Tahvildari, Kostas Kontogiannis: On the Role of Design Patterns in Quality-Driven Re-engineering. CSMR 2002: 230-240 |
45 | EE | Derek Rayside, Kostas Kontogiannis: A Generic Worklist Algorithm for Graph Reachability Problems in Program Analysis. CSMR 2002: 67-76 |
44 | EE | Ying Zou, Kostas Kontogiannis: Migration to Object Oriented Platforms: A State Transformation Approach. ICSM 2002: 530-539 |
43 | EE | Ladan Tahvildari, Kostas Kontogiannis: A Software Transformation Framework for Quality-Driven Object-Oriented Re-engineering. ICSM 2002: 596- |
42 | EE | Ladan Tahvildari, Kostas Kontogiannis: A Methodology for Developing Transformations Using the Maintainability Soft-Goal Graph. WCRE 2002: 77- |
41 | EE | Derek Rayside, Kostas Kontogiannis: Extracting Java library subsets for deployment on embedded systems. Sci. Comput. Program. 45(2): 245-270 (2002) |
2001 | ||
40 | EE | Ying Zou, Kostas Kontogiannis: A Framework for Migrating Procedural Code to Object-Oriented Platforms. APSEC 2001: 390-499 |
39 | Derek Rayside, Kostas Kontogiannis: On the Syllogistic Structure of Object-Oriented Programming. ICSE 2001: 113-122 | |
38 | Jens H. Jahnke, Kostas Kontogiannis, Eleni Stroulia, Scott R. Tilley, Kenny Wong: 3rd International Workshop on Net-Centric Computing (NCC 2001): Theme: Migrating to the Web. ICSE 2001: 766-767 | |
37 | EE | Kamran Sartipi, Kostas Kontogiannis: A Graph Pattern Matching Approach to Software Architecture Recovery. ICSM 2001: 408- |
36 | EE | Frankie Poon, Kostas Kontogiannis: i-Cube: A Tool-Set for the Dynamic Extraction and Integration of Web Data Content. ISEC 2001: 98-115 |
35 | EE | Kamran Sartipi, Kostas Kontogiannis: Component Clustering Based on Maximal Association. WCRE 2001: 103-114 |
34 | EE | Ladan Tahvildari, Kostas Kontogiannis, John Mylopoulos: Requirements-Driven Software Re-engineering Framework. WCRE 2001: 71-80 |
2000 | ||
33 | EE | Ying Zou, Kostas Kontogiannis: Web-based specification and integration of legacy services. CASCON 2000: 17 |
32 | EE | Kamran Sartipi, Kostas Kontogiannis, Farhad Mavaddat: Architectural Design Recovery using Data Mining Techniques. CSMR 2000: 129-140 |
31 | EE | Kostas Kontogiannis, Richard Gregory: Customizable Service Integration in Web-Enabled Environments. EDO 2000: 235-252 |
30 | EE | Ying Zou, Kostas Kontogiannis: Migrating and Specifying Services for Web Integration. EDO 2000: 253-270 |
29 | EE | Derek Rayside, Steve Reuss, Erik Hedges, Kostas Kontogiannis: The Effect of Call Graph Construction Algorithms for Object-Oriented Programs on Automatic Clustering. IWPC 2000: 191-200 |
28 | EE | Kamran Sartipi, Kostas Kontogiannis, Farhad Mavaddat: A Pattern Matching Framework for Software Architecture Recovery and Restructuring. IWPC 2000: 37-47 |
27 | EE | Evan Mamas, Kostas Kontogiannis: Towards Portable Source Code Representations using XML. WCRE 2000: 172- |
26 | EE | S. Muthanna, Kostas Kontogiannis, Kumaraswamy Ponnambalam, B. Stacey: A Maintainability Model for Industrial Software Systems using Design Level Metrics. WCRE 2000: 248- |
25 | EE | Magdalena Balazinska, Ettore Merlo, Michel Dagenais, Bruno Laguë, Kostas Kontogiannis: Advanced Clone-Analysis to Support Object-Oriented System Refactoring. WCRE 2000: 98-107 |
24 | EE | Weidong Kou, David Lauzon, William G. O'Farrell, Teo Loo See, Daniel Wee, Daniel Tan, Kelvin Cheung, Richard Gregory, Kostas Kontogiannis, John Mylopoulos: End-to-end E-commerce Application Development Based on XML Tools. IEEE Data Eng. Bull. 23(1): 29-36 (2000) |
1999 | ||
23 | EE | Ladan Tahvildari, Richard Gregory, Kostas Kontogiannis: An Approach for Measuring Software Evolution Using Source Code Features. APSEC 1999: 10-17 |
22 | EE | Prashant Patil, Ying Zou, Kostas Kontogiannis, John Mylopoulos: Migration of procedural systems to network-centric platforms. CASCON 1999: 8 |
21 | EE | Derek Rayside, Kostas Kontogiannis: Extracting Java Library Subsets for Deployment on Embedded Systems. CSMR 1999: 102-110 |
20 | EE | Magdalena Balazinska, Ettore Merlo, Michel Dagenais, Bruno Laguë, Kostas Kontogiannis: Measuring Clone Based Reengineering Opportunities. IEEE METRICS 1999: 292-303 |
19 | EE | Magdalena Balazinska, Ettore Merlo, Michel Dagenais, Bruno Laguë, Kostas Kontogiannis: Partial Redesign of Java Software Systems Based on Clone Analysis. WCRE 1999: 326-336 |
1998 | ||
18 | EE | Kostas Kontogiannis, Johannes Martin, Kenny Wong, Richard Gregory, Hausi A. Müller, John Mylopoulos: Code migration through transformations: an experience report. CASCON 1998: 13 |
17 | Derek Rayside, Scott Kerr, Kostas Kontogiannis: Change And Adaptive Maintenance in Java Software Systems. WCRE 1998: 10-19 | |
1997 | ||
16 | EE | Kostas Kontogiannis: Evaluation Experiments on the Detection of Programming Patterns Using Software Metrics. WCRE 1997: 44- |
15 | Patrick J. Finnigan, Richard C. Holt, Ivan Kalas, Scott Kerr, Kostas Kontogiannis, Hausi A. Müller, John Mylopoulos, Stephen G. Perelgut, Martin Stanley, Kenny Wong: The Software Bookshelf. IBM Systems Journal 36(4): 564-593 (1997) | |
1996 | ||
14 | John Mylopoulos, Avigdor Gal, Kostas Kontogiannis, Martin Stanley: A Generic Integration Architecture for Cooperative Information Systems. CoopIS 1996: 208-217 | |
13 | Kostas Kontogiannis, Renato de Mori, Ettore Merlo, M. Galler, Morris Bernstein: Pattern Matching for Clone and Concept Detection. Autom. Softw. Eng. 3(1/2): 77-108 (1996) | |
1995 | ||
12 | EE | Michael J. Whitney, Morris Bernstein, Renato de Mori, Kostas Kontogiannis, Brain Corrie, Hausi A. Müller, Scott R. Tilley, Ettore Merlo, John Mylopoulos, Kenny Wong, J. Howard Johnson, James McDaniel, Martin Stanley: Using an integrated toolset for program understanding. CASCON 1995: 59 |
11 | Kostas Kontogiannis, Renato de Mori, Morris Bernstein, M. Galler, Ettore Merlo: Pattern Matching for Design Concept Localization. WCRE 1995: 0- | |
10 | Kostas Kontogiannis, Peter G. Selfridge: Workshop Report: The Two-Day Workshop on Research Issues in the Intersection between Software Engineering and Artificial Intelligence (Held in conjunction with ICSE-16). Autom. Softw. Eng. 2(1): 87-97 (1995) | |
9 | EE | Ettore Merlo, Pierre-Yves Gagné, Jean-Francois Girard, Kostas Kontogiannis, Laurie J. Hendren, Prakash Panangaden, Renato de Mori: Reengineering User Interfaces. IEEE Software 12(1): 64-73 (1995) |
1994 | ||
8 | EE | Kostas Kontogiannis: Partial design recovery using dynamic programming. CASCON 1994: 34 |
7 | EE | John Mylopoulos, Martin Stanley, Kenny Wong, Morris Bernstein, Renato de Mori, Graham W. Ewart, Kostas Kontogiannis, Ettore Merlo, Hausi A. Müller, Scott R. Tilley, Marijana Tomic: Towards an integrated toolset for program understanding. CASCON 1994: 48 |
6 | Kostas Kontogiannis, Renato de Mori, Morris Bernstein, Ettore Merlo: Localization of Design Concepts in Legacy Systems. ICSM 1994: 414-423 | |
5 | Erich B. Buss, Renato de Mori, W. Morven Gentleman, John Henshaw, J. Howard Johnson, Kostas Kontogiannis, Ettore Merlo, Hausi A. Müller, John Mylopoulos, Santanu Paul, Atul Prakash, Martin Stanley, Scott R. Tilley, Joel Troster, Kenny Wong: Investigating Reverse Engineering Technologies for the CAS Program Understanding Project. IBM Systems Journal 33(3): 477-500 (1994) | |
1993 | ||
4 | EE | Kostas Kontogiannis: Program representation and behavioural matching for localizing similar code fragments. CASCON 1993: 194-205 |
3 | EE | Kostas Kontogiannis, Morris Bernstein, Ettore Merlo, Renato de Mori: The development of a partial design recovery environment for legacy systems. CASCON 1993: 206-216 |
2 | Ettore Merlo, Jean-Francois Girard, Kostas Kontogiannis, Prakash Panangaden, Renato de Mori: Reverse Engineering of User Interfaces. WCRE 1993: 171-179 | |
1992 | ||
1 | EE | Kostas Kontogiannis: Toward program representation and program understanding using process algebras. CASCON 1992: 299-317 |